Dr. Balvant Arora is a Board-Certified Plastic, Reconstructive and Cosmetic Surgeon who has been practicing for more than 20 years and has expertise in a variety of advanced aesthetic surgical techniques, as well as reconstructive surgery and hair restoration.
As an active member of the American Society of Plastic Surgeons (ASPS) and an Associate Member of the International Society of Hair Restoration Surgery (ISHRS), Dr. Arora has many awards for his contributions to the field of plastic surgery and hair restoration. In addition, he has been invited to participate in numerous national and international conferences, seminars and broadcasts to share his knowledge and expertise on aesthetic surgery, reconstructive surgery and hair restoration.
Dr. Arora began his medical career as a certified plastic surgeon (by the Medical Council of India) before relocating to the United States in 1992. He received his ECFMG certification (for use in U.S. Medicine) in 1994, completed a General Surgery Residency at Stony Brook University Hospital, and completed a Plastic Surgery Residency at Oregon Health Sciences University with a Cosmetic Surgery Fellowship at Lenox Hill Hospital in New York City.
